Post by: burn_your_money on January 31, 2008, 09:02:22 am
westy has lots of meanings,

in the rabbit world it is the ones made in PA, not germany

As mentioned it is also for westfalias

And in the mk2 world it describes exactly what is on your car

Westy (in this case) is referring to the fact that the car was built in Westmoreland PA. The cars from Westmoreland came with some nifty headlights including the headlamps that only came on the few cars built in Westmoreland.
